Wondering if anyone has gone through the CFO course for a K-1 visa lately and what are your experiences? Mainly interested in the types of documentation they will ask for. I am seeing sites reporting that my fiance may need to provide things like: 1. Affidavit of invitation and support (financial support/safety/medical insurance) written by the sponsoring spouse notarized and authenticated by the Philippine Embassy or Consulate which has jurisdiction over the destination or host country, 2. Declaration of undertaking of travel in letter format to include an itinerary of travel and how to ensure safe travel and stay, and 3. Letter explaining why the foreign partner cannot travel to the Philippines. Has anyone ever actually been asked for any of those above listed items. I want to be as prepared as possible, but do I really need to go find a Philippines Consulate to notarize a statement of support??
